Description
Fault Status Register for the 7 SFD's
Fault Status Register for the 4 GPI's and the Watchdog Detector
Description
If high, then a change in logic status (fault) has been logged on one of the 12 func-
monitored since the last time the Fault Registers were read.
If high, then a fault has occurred on supply at input VP4
If high, then a fault has occurred on supply at input VP3
If high, then a fault has occurred on supply at input VP2
If high, then a fault has occurred on supply at input VP1
If high, then a fault has occurred on supply at input VH
If high, then a fault has occurred on supply at input VB2
If high, then a fault has occurred on supply at input VB1
Description
Cannot be used
If high, then the logic level on the WDI output has changed since the last
time that the fault registers were read
If high, then the logic level on GPI4 input has changed since the last
time that the fault registers were read
If high, then the logic level on GPI3 input has changed since the last
time that the fault registers were read
If high, then the logic level on GPI2 input has changed since the last
time that the fault registers were read
If high, then the logic level on GPI1 input has changed since the last
time that the fault registers were read
